- 2
- 0
- 约3.68千字
- 约 38页
- 2018-03-02 发布于浙江
- 举报
[化学]微机原理实验1
在EDIT文本编辑器中建立好源程序后,用Alt键激活菜单,存盘,并退出EDIT文本编辑器。 * 微机原理实验 教学目的 掌握汇编语言程序设计及调试方法 增强对微机接口技术的感性认识, 巩固、加深对理论知识的理解, 提高实践动手能力 课程实施计划 实验总时数: 20学时.共5个实验内容 实验一 上机过程与DEBUG应用 和寻址方式练习 (讲义中的实验1、2) 实验二 串处理程序和分支程序设计 (讲义中的实验3、4) 实验三 循环程序设计 (讲义中的实验5) 实验四 输入/输出接口设计与编程(实验7、8) 实验五 8255A可编程接口芯片应用(实验9) 考核办法 实验课成绩管理方法:微机原理实验课成绩必需达到及格,理论课成绩有效;实验课成绩不及格者,理论课成绩视为不及格。 实验课成绩计算方法:实验课成绩=各个实验的成绩之和。 单个实验成绩考核方法:每个实验的成绩分为两个部分:一个为实验验收成绩,另一部分为报告成绩。 实验验收成绩由任课教师在学生做完实验后,根据学生的实验表现、实验结果的正确与否等因素给与5,4,3,2,1,0的评分档次。 批改实验报告时,根据记录在原始数据记录纸的实验验收成绩档次,结合报告的书写完整性、正确性和工整性给与±1或 -2的修正值。 注:无教师印章(或签名)的原始记录纸,该次实验成绩计为0。 0 7 12 14 16 18 对应分数 0 1 2 3 4 5 评分档次 实验须知 做好实验预习工作 明确实验目的 了解实验任务与要求,给出正确算法 设计好硬件电路,编写实验程序等 实验报告要求 格式规范,书写认真,字迹清晰,流程完整. 书写实验题目、实验目的、实验仪器与器材、实验原理与任务、实验体会与建议等内容. 根据具体任务,给出相应的实验数据、硬件电路图、流程图及程序清单. 注意事项 进入实验室者不允许携带、食用各种食物,不得乱扔废纸、杂物。 爱护实验设备,实验结束后应整理好设备、导线、工具等,并由教师验收。 每次实验结束后, 留8人打扫卫生并登记姓名,每人至少打扫卫生一次。 按课表时间参加实验,逾期不补。 第5个实验是开放性实验,可根据自己的情况,自由利用实验室的仪器设备,自选实验内容,亦可选做课外内容,完成综合性实验。 开机过程 在登录界面中选 MS-DOS 系统提示符为 D: 实验的所有操作均在D盘下进行 DOS命令: DIR 列文件目录 DIR *.ASM 列.ASM文件目录 DIR/P 分页列文件目录 实验一 上机过程及动态调试DEBUG应用 实验目的: 学习EDIT,MASM,LINK 及 DEBUG等工具软件的使用方法. 深入了解DEBUG动态调试软件的应用, 掌握DEBUG命令的使用方法. 实际感受段地址,偏移地址,存储器组织及CPU寄存器等概念 实验任务 把内存单元DATA1和DATA2中的两个字(十六进制)相加,结果存入SUM单元 上机过程和方法 以该任务为例,说明上机过程和实验方法 . 1. 建立源程序 .ASM D:EDIT 文件名.ASM↙ STACK SEGMENT PARA STACK ‘STACK’ DW 100H DUP (?) TOP LABEL WORD STACK ENDS DATA SEGMENT DATA1 DW 1234H DATA2 DW 5678H SUM DW ? DATA ENDS CODE SEGMENT MAIN PROC FAR ASSUME CS: CODE,DS:DATA,SS:STACK START:MOV AX, STACK MOV SS, AX MOV SP, OFFSET TOP PUSH DS SUB AX,AX PUSH AX MOV AX, DATA MOV DS, AX MOV AX, DATA1 ADD AX, DATA2 MOV SUM, AX RET MAIN ENDP CODE ENDS END START 2. 汇编生成 .OBJ文件 D:MASM ADD.ASM↙ Object f
原创力文档

文档评论(0)